W. R. Berkley Corporation Names Christopher H. Balch President of Berkley Technology Underwriters

GREENWICH, Conn.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--W. R. Berkley Corporation (NYSE: WRB) today announced the appointment of Christopher H. Balch as president of Berkley Technology Underwriters, a Berkley company. He succeeds Matthew A. Mueller, who has been named chairman of the business. The appointments are effective immediately.

Mr. Balch joins Berkley Technology Underwriters with nearly 20 years of experience in the property and casualty insurance industry. He has extensive leadership experience, most recently in insurance distribution. His prior experience includes various technical and management roles at a leading national insurance company with a particular focus in the commercial insurance market.

Mr. Mueller joined Berkley as president of Berkley Technology Underwriters when it was formed in 2011. Under his leadership, the business has grown to become an important participant in the market for technology coverages. As chairman, he will support the Berkley Technology Underwriters team through the transition and remain a key member of the W. R. Berkley Corporation team.

Commenting on the appointment W. Robert Berkley, Jr., president and chief executive officer of W. R. Berkley Corporation, said, “We are extremely grateful to Matt for his outstanding contributions to our organization. He was instrumental in the establishment and development of Berkley Technology Underwriters, and we are fortunate to have him continuing as chairman of the business. Chris is an accomplished executive, and we are excited to have him lead the talented Berkley Technology Underwriters team going forward.”

Berkley Technology Underwriters is a leading provider of property, casualty and professional insurance coverages for clients with technology exposure and technology firms worldwide. Please visit www.berkley-tech.com for more information.

Founded in 1967, W. R. Berkley Corporation is an insurance holding company that is among the largest commercial lines writers in the United States and operates worldwide in two segments of the property casualty insurance business: Insurance and Reinsurance & Monoline Excess. For further information about W. R. Berkley Corporation, please visit www.berkley.com.
